How To Fix EMV118 - Customer contact for welcome letter could not be created


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: EMV - Reserved for IS-U: move-in/out

  • Message number: 118

  • Message text: Customer contact for welcome letter could not be created

    The SAP error message EMV118, which states "Customer contact for welcome letter could not be created," typically occurs in the context of customer relationship management (CRM) or customer onboarding processes. This error indicates that the system was unable to generate a customer contact record necessary for sending a welcome letter to a new customer.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Data: Required fields for creating a customer contact may be missing or incomplete. This could include customer details such as name, address, or contact information.
    2. Configuration Issues: There may be issues with the configuration settings in the SAP system related to customer contact management or the welcome letter process.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user attempting to create the contact may not have the necessary permissions to perform this action.
    4. System Errors: There could be underlying system errors or bugs that are preventing the creation of the contact.
    5. Integration Issues: If the welcome letter process involves integration with other systems (e.g., third-party applications), any issues in those integrations could lead to this error.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Required Fields: Ensure that all mandatory fields for customer contact creation are filled out correctly. Review the customer master data for completeness.
    2.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ings in the SAP system related to customer contacts and welcome letters. Ensure that all necessary settings are correctly configured.
    3. User Permissions: Verify that the user has the appropriate authorizations to create customer contacts. If not, adjust the user roles or permissions accordingly.
    4. Error Logs: Review system logs or error messages for more detailed information about the failure. This can provide insights into what specifically went wrong.
    5. Test in a Development Environment: If possible, replicate the issue in a development or test environment to troubleshoot without affecting production data.
    6.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or support notes related to EMV118 for any specific guidance or known issues.
    7.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and cannot be resolved through the above steps,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
